Description

This beautifully illustrated, full-color introduction to astronomy is packed with intriguing information about the night sky and the Universe within which we live. The smart, visually led approach features fast facts and clear, to-the-point information, making this guide equally essential for armchair enthusiasts and aspiring astronauts. It features spotters' guides to celestial objects including the constellations, comets, and planets. Find out how the planets and stars move through the sky; how objects in space formed; and what stargazing can tell us about our incredible Universe. Author Biography:

William Potter is a talented and versatile author of children's and adult non-fiction and comic books. His comic book oeuvre includes well-known properties such as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les and Sonic the Comic. He has also successfully kickstarted the creator-owned comic Geezer in collaboration with Philip Bond. This fictional story of a Britpop band is based on William's experiences as the bassist of real-life indie band CUD. He lives in Haslemere, UK. Rhys Jefferys is an illustrator whose colorful work tends to focus on the fun and educational side of children's books. He is based in Vancouver.
